Output 8598da5a55291a02ea6c809d9e8c1288d031457d4dc600387f15055e7074026f:5

value
6115469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7af9086c9f780545eb34c6bc825b274867c08c5 OP_EQUAL
address
3Np4LJ7SVa1Jskcpqc5yaiCuWTu9KLtEKU
transaction
8598da5a55291a02ea6c809d9e8c1288d031457d4dc600387f15055e7074026f
spent
true